Warning Signs You Need Kitchen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ore them, address the issue before it becomes a major headache.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

That persistent, unpleasant smell in your kitchen could be a sign of hidden water damage. Our team will help you identify the source and provide a solution to remove the odor.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or discolor, leading to a weakened structural integrity. Our team will assess and repair or replace any damaged flooring to ensure your kitchen is safe and functional.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el, leading to further damage if left unchecked. Our team will repair or replace any affected areas, ensuring a smooth finish.

Visible Water Stains

Those unsightly water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a larger issue. Our team will ident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Water Damage in Cabinets or Behind Walls

Water damage can seep into cabinets or behind walls, leading to hidden issues that can compromise the structural integrity of your kitchen. Our team will detect and repair any hidden damage, ensuring your kitchen is safe and secure.

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or leak with no visible damage Yes Maybe Small leaks can be fixed quickly and easily with DIY methods.
Visible water damage with warped flooring No Yes Visible water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ure structural integrity.
Water damage behind walls or in cabinets No Yes Hidden water damage needs professional detection and repair to prevent further damage and compromise the structural integrity of your kitchen.
Musty odors with no visible damage No Yes Musty odors can be a sign of hidden water damage, needing professional attention to remove the odor and prevent further damage.

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Cost in Palmerton, PA

Prices for Kitchen Water Damage Restoration v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Palmerton, PA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should serve as a guide only.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water extracted
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and duration of drying process
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and level of cleaning required
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and complexity of repair

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and free estimates are available.

Common Questions About Kitchen Water Damage Restoration

How Long Does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Take?

The length of time required for Kitchen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ity of the damage and the complexity of the repair. But, our team strives to complete projects within 3-5 days, ensuring minimal downtime for you and your family.

Is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Covered by Insurance?

Yes, Kitchen Water Damage Restoration is typically covered by homeowner’s insurance. But, the extent of coverage and the deductible amount may vary depending on your policy and provider.

What Happens If I Wait Too Long to Address Water Damage?

Waiting too long to address water damage can lead to further damage, structural compromise, and costly repairs. It’s essential to address the issue as soon as possible to prevent these complications.

Can I Prevent Water Damage in My Kitchen?

Yes, you can prevent water damage in your kitchen by regularly inspecting your plumbing, checking for leaks, and maintaining your appliances. Also, installing a water sensor or leak detection system can provide an added layer of protection.
